Capacity note for plugin authors: tailcast, the internal log-tailing CLI at Ferrowick, multiplexes streams through a single broker per region. Each plugin attaching a follower consumes one broker slot plus buffer memory proportional to line rate. Exceeding the slot cap queues your session. Keep filters server-side; client-side regex burns broker CPU. Defaults suit most plugins; override only with cause. The broker enforces these limits with the constants listed below.

tuning constants:
BUDGETS = {
    "druath": 240,
    "lamwyn": 180,
    "silael": 275,
}

## Deploying the Gatewick Proctor Queue

Deploys are pretty painless: push to main, wait for the pipeline, then watch the queue drain dashboard for five minutes. If candidates pile up mid-exam, roll back first and ask questions later — the queue replays safely. Everything the workers care about lives in one config block, shown here for reference.

settings of bafof-yagef:
JOROX_PIN=8740
JOROX_TENANT=pelox
JOROX_METRICS_HOST=metrics.jorox.qorvelworks.internal
JOROX_SEAL=seal_c78f63c1
JOROX_STANDBY_TEAM=norax

# Artifact Signing — Sproutbox Greenhouse Controller

Quick context for reviewers: the sensor-drift compensation patch (the one recalibrating humidity readings every six hours) goes out as a signed firmware bundle. Don't approve a release PR unless the drift regression suite passed and the bundle is signed — unsigned firmware bricks the updater on older controllers, and nobody wants to drive out to a greenhouse at 6 a.m. The CI signer occasionally flakes, so manual signing is sometimes needed. For that case, the signing key is below.

deploy key for hawef-yadup: bky19_kVT4YunTZZSTyhFQQoK